Description
Introduction for Northrop Grumman
Join Northrop Grumman on our continued mission to push the boundaries of possible across land, sea, air, space, and cyberspace. Enjoy a culture where your voice is valued and start contributing to our team of passionate professionals providing real-life solutions to our world's biggest challenges. We take pride in creating purposeful work and allowing our employees to grow and achieve their goals every day by Defining Possible. With our competitive pay and comprehensive benefits, we have the right opportunities to fit your life and launch your career today.
Introduction for Mission Systems
At the heart of Defining Possible is our commitment to missions. In rapidly changing global security environments, Northrop Grumman brings informed insights and software-secure technology to enable strategic planning. We're looking for innovators who can help us keep building on our wide portfolio of secure, affordable, integrated, and multi-domain systems and technologies that fuel those missions. By joining in our shared mission, we'll support yours of expanding your personal network and developing skills, whether you are new to the field, or an industry thought leader. At Northrop Grumman, you'll have the resources, support, and team to do some of the best work of your career.
We are looking for you to join our team as a Principal Cyber Software Engineer based out of Tampa, FL .
Note: Due to the classified nature of the work being performed, this position does not offer any virtual or telecommute working options. Applicants are encouraged to apply, only if they are willing to work on-site.
What you will get to do
• Be involved in a fast-paced software development team using modern software and hardware Be involved in a fast-paced software development team using modern software and hardware
• Facilitate the creation and maintenance of mission critical software solutions actively used by a government customer Facilitate the creation and maintenance of mission critical software solutions actively used by a government customer
• Support rigorously defined and executed software deployment practices Support rigorously defined and executed software deployment practices
• Utilize your creativity and ideas to integrate open source, COTS, GOTS, and closed source software to build a larger system solutions based on customer requirements Utilize your creativity and ideas to integrate open source, COTS, GOTS, and closed source software to build a larger system solutions based on customer requirements
Responsibilities
• Engineer enterprise solutions that align with best practices to support mission critical objectives. Engineer enterprise solutions that align with best practices to support mission critical objectives.
• Participate in regular project design and incremental status meetings. Participate in regular project design and incremental status meetings.
• Collaborate with different teams across the program to discuss, analyze or resolve usability issues and work on projects. Collaborate with different teams across the program to discuss, analyze or resolve usability issues and work on projects.
• Work on 1-3 mid- to large-scale projects concurrently, assigned from program and internal leadership. Work on 1-3 mid- to large-scale projects concurrently, assigned from program and internal leadership.
• Provide effective communication across multi-functional teams, stakeholders and end users. Provide effective communication across multi-functional teams, stakeholders and end users.
Basic Qualifications
• US Citizenship US Citizenship
• Interim Top Secret security clearance to be considered. Full TS/SCI clearance must be obtained for continued employment. Interim Top Secret security clearance to be considered. Full TS/SCI clearance must be obtained for continued employment.
• Masters Degree with 3 years of experience; or a Bachelors Degree with 5 years of experience; or an Associates Degree with 7 years of experience; or a High School Diploma (or equivalent) with 9 years of IT experience is required. Masters Degree with 3 years of experience; or a Bachelors Degree with 5 years of experience; or an Associates Degree with 7 years of experience; or a High School Diploma (or equivalent) with 9 years of IT experience is required.
• Must possess a current DoD 8570 Certification for IAT Level II or higher within three months of start date (example: Security+ CE) Must possess a current DoD 8570 Certification for IAT Level II or higher within three months of start date (example: Security+ CE)
• Experience with Python programming fundamentals and usage of python virtual environments Experience with Python programming fundamentals and usage of python virtual environments
• Experience with PKI/TLS security requirements and best practices Experience with PKI/TLS security requirements and best practices
• Experience with virtualization platforms such as VMWare or Proxmox Experience with virtualization platforms such as VMWare or Proxmox
• Experience working with Windows Active Directory in custom software Experience working with Windows Active Directory in custom software
• Experience developing software integrating with SQL Experience developing software integrating with SQL
• Experience developing and integrating with JSON APIs Experience developing and integrating with JSON APIs
• Experience writing command line scripts and operating on the command line Experience writing command line scripts and operating on the command line
Preferred Qualifications
• Active Top Secret / SCI security clearance. Active Top Secret / SCI security clearance.
• Experience with container management using CLI tools like Docker, Podman, Kubernetes, Compose, and systemd Experience with container management using CLI tools like Docker, Podman, Kubernetes, Compose, and systemd
• System Build Automation (Ansible, Red Hat Ansible Tower, Red Hat Automation Controller) and PostgreSQL to include understanding of various Ansible Modules and Ansible debugging System Build Automation (Ansible, Red Hat Ansible Tower, Red Hat Automation Controller) and PostgreSQL to include understanding of various Ansible Modules and Ansible debugging
• Proficiency in one or more of the following languages is preferred: PowerShell, Python, Bash, JavaScript, C/C++, or YAML (executed/managed via Ansible). Proficiency in one or more of the following languages is preferred: PowerShell, Python, Bash, JavaScript, C/C++, or YAML (executed/managed via Ansible).
• Experience with multiple Linux distributions with a focus on Red Hat Enterprise Linux and Ubuntu Experience with multiple Linux distributions with a focus on Red Hat Enterprise Linux and Ubuntu
• A strong understanding of virtual infrastructure: Ability to design, deploy, manage, maintain, and upgrade VMware vCenter, ESXi, NSX-T, Horizon VDI environments, and Tanzu Kubernetes Grid A strong understanding of virtual infrastructure: Ability to design, deploy, manage, maintain, and upgrade VMware vCenter, ESXi, NSX-T, Horizon VDI environments, and Tanzu Kubernetes Grid
• Multi-threaded software applications programming Multi-threaded software applications programming
• Knowledge of networking concepts like IP, TCP, UDP, port binding, NAT, layer 3, firewalls and analysis of live traffic using tools like tcpdump or wireshark Knowledge of networking concepts like IP, TCP, UDP, port binding, NAT, layer 3, firewalls and analysis of live traffic using tools like tcpdump or wireshark
Northrop Grumman solves the toughest problems in space, aeronautics, defense and cyberspace to meet the ever-evolving needs of our customers worldwide. Our 90,000 employees are Defining Possible every day using science, technology and engineering to create and deliver advanced systems, products and services. Northrop Grumman careers and internships are as varied as your interests, with a lifetime of potential that will allow you to work together with people from many backgrounds, personal passions and disciplines.
© 2020 Northrop Grumman is committed to hiring and retaining a diverse workforce. We are proud to be an Equal Opportunity/Affirmative Action Employer, making decisions without regard to race, color, religion, creed, sex, sexual orientation, gender identity, marital status, national origin, age, veteran status, disability, or any other protected class. U.S. Citizenship is required for most positions. For our complete EEO/AA and Pay Transparency statement, please visit www.northropgrumman.com/EEO